Certificate Programs in WHRE
- Certificates offers a shorter course of study than a degree.
- Certificates can serve as stepping stones to a degree, and
as credentials to advance your education and career.
- Certificates provide additional recognition of professional
expertise, particularly when combined with a degree.
- Certificates are a reflection of a commitment to lifelong
learning.
When successfully completed, certificates are listed on a student's
transcript. With program faculty approval, credits completed in
a certificate program may be transferred into a degree program.
Degree and non-degree-seeking students are eligible to apply
for certificates. Many students who pursue a baccalaureate, master's
or doctoral degree add to their credential by getting a certificate.
